CM d'Architecture des ordinateurs
(ESIPE 1)
Thèmes abordés
- CM 1, 26 septembre 2016 :
(diapos du cours)
histoire des ordinateurs et notions théoriques des machines
actuelles ; représentation des données (idées principales,
boutisme).
- CM 2, 30 septembre 2016 :
(diapos du cours)
codages des entiers ; codage des flottants.
- CM 3, 3 octobre 2016 :
(diapos du cours)
codage des caractères et des textes ; langages d'assemblage ;
manipulation de registres ; manipulation de la mémoire ;
section de données.
- CM 4, 10 octobre 2016 :
(diapos du cours)
sections de données non initialisées ; interruptions ;
assemblage ; étiquettes d'instructions ; sauts conditionnels ;
sauts inconditionnels ; pile ; instructions call
et ret.
- CM 5, 17 octobre 2016 :
(diapos du cours)
fonctions et convention d'appel du C ; exemples de fonctions ;
pipelines.
Fiches et fichiers de TP
- Séances 1 et 2 (à rendre avant le 10 oct. 2016, 13 h 45)
- Séance 3 (à rendre avant le 17 oct. 2016, 13 h 45)
- Séances 4 et 5 (à rendre avant le 24 oct. 2016, 13 h 45)
- Séance 6 (à rendre avant le 24 oct. 2016, 13 h 50)
Cours intégral
Disponible ici, en version
imprimable ici et en version
imprimable avec 4 pages sur 1 ici.
Divers
- Le site
où trouver le livre Langage Assembleur PC.
- Un lien vers une liste assez complète de commandes
pour gdb.